the main netplay client/server app added to emulation is kaillera. however, the client only sends joystick requests as if the game is running on a single system. the gba link cable sends info while the game(s) are running on multiple systems. for this reason other ideas have come up but with the problem of lag. there is a large amount of data that can be transmitted and it has not been a practical project.

the only app to gain any wide spread use is vbalink. a fork of the visualboy emulator that contains wireless linking for up to 4 virtual gameboy advances. i have not played with it myself, i'm not sure it requires being hosted on a fast server or if wireless lan is the only way to use it. but i'm sure now that i have mentioned it you can do your own research.
